class WhisperTokenizerFast(PreTrainedTokenizerFast):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Construct a "fast" Whisper tokenizer (backed by HuggingFace's *tokenizers* library).
|
||||
|
||||
This tokenizer inherits from [`PreTrainedTokenizerFast`] which contains most of the main methods. Users should
|
||||
refer to this superclass for more information regarding those methods.
|
||||
|
||||
Args:
|
||||
vocab_file (`str`):
|
||||
Path to the vocabulary file.
|
||||
merges_file (`str`):
|
||||
Path to the merges file.
|
||||
normalizer_file (`str`, *optional*, defaults to `None`):
|
||||
Path to the normalizer_file file.
|
||||
errors (`str`, *optional*, defaults to `"replace"`):
|
||||
Paradigm to follow when decoding bytes to UTF-8. See
|
||||
[bytes.decode](https://docs.python.org/3/library/stdtypes.html#bytes.decode) for more information.
|
||||
unk_token (`str`, *optional*, defaults to `<|endoftext|>`):
|
||||
The unknown token. A token that is not in the vocabulary cannot be converted to an ID and is set to be this
|
||||
token instead.
|
||||
bos_token (`str`, *optional*, defaults to `<|startoftranscript|>`):
|
||||
The beginning of sequence token.
|
||||
eos_token (`str`, *optional*, defaults to `<|endoftext|>`):
|
||||
The end of sequence token.
|
||||
add_prefix_space (`bool`, *optional*, defaults to `False`):
|
||||
Whether or not to add an initial space to the input. This allows to treat the leading word just as any
|
||||
other word. (Whisper tokenizer detect beginning of words by the preceding space).
|
||||
trim_offsets (`bool`, *optional*, defaults to `True`):
|
||||
Whether or not the post-processing step should trim offsets to avoid including whitespaces.
|
||||
language (`str`, *optional*):
|
||||
The language of the transcription text. The corresponding language id token is appended to the start of the
|
||||
sequence for multilingual speech recognition and speech translation tasks, e.g. for Spanish the token
|
||||
`"<|es|>"` is appended to the start of sequence. This should be used for multilingual fine-tuning only.
|
||||
task (`str`, *optional*):
|
||||
Task identifier to append at the start of sequence (if any). This should be used for mulitlingual
|
||||
fine-tuning, with `"transcribe"` for speech recognition and `"translate"` for speech translation.
|
||||
predict_timestamps (`bool`, *optional*, defaults to `False`):
|
||||
Whether to omit the `<|notimestamps|>` token at the start of the sequence.
|
||||
"""
